New York, Jan 6, 2026, 20:14 EST — Market closed Bank of America Corp said it changed accounting methods for certain tax-related equity investments, an adjustment that would have cut its common equity tier 1 (CET1) ratio — a key measure of bank capital — by 13 basis points as of Sept. 30, 2025, on a pro forma basis. Applied retrospectively, retained earnings as of Sept. 30 fell $1.7 billion and CET1 capital would have decreased about $2.1 billion, it said; it also estimated its third-quarter effective tax rate would have been about 20% versus 10.4% previously reported. CapitaLand Investment shares rose 1.3% to S$3.12 on Friday, bucking a 0.8% drop in Singapore’s benchmark index. CapitaLand Integrated Commercial Trust reported a 16.4% jump in second-half distributable income, while CapitaLand Ascendas REIT posted a 1.4% full-year rise. CapitaLand China Trust saw full-year DPU fall to 4.82 cents amid weaker yuan and occupancy. CLI reports FY2025 results on Feb. 11.
